This analysis of the historical formation of the observer is a compelling account of the prehistory of the society of the spectacle. 2012-05-09 · Jonathan Crary does not agree with this interpretation. His deeply ambiguously received book Techniques of the Observer: On Vision and Modernity in the 19th Century foregrounds the discontinuity between the camera obscura and photography and claims that the rupture between modern and classical vision took place at the beginning of the 19th century.

Crary studies “historical construction of vision” – more exactly, “reconfiguration of relations between an observing subject and modes of representation” (p. 1). He speaks of the modern (or post-modern) subject: subjectivity as “a precarious condition of interface between rationalized systems of exchange and networks of information” (p.

Crary argues that since the nineteenth century, human knowledge of the visual perception and on one’s ability, as an observer, to perceive the world objectively, becomes increasingly challenged (starting with Kant). This week’s reading was from Techniques of the Observer by Jonathan Crary. In his book he explores different devices that aide in our perception such as the stereoscope and the camera obscura. He also is seeking ways to categorize the history of vision and prefers this to a study of art history.
